Additional cast members and the main promotional video for the TV anime A Misanthrope Teaches a Class for Demi-Humans have been revealed. The newly released main PV features the opening theme “Ningen”, performed by Masayoshi Oishi. The series is scheduled to premiere in Japan on January 10, 2026.

ADDITIONAL CAST:
Honoka Inoue as Mirai Haruna
Kazuhiko Inoue as Shiro Karasuma
Makoto Ishii as Satoru Hoshino
Ai Kayano as Yuki Saotome

CAST:
Toshiki Masuda as Rei Hitoma
Sora Amamiya as Kyoka Minazuki
Saori Onishi as Isaki Ohgami
Maria Naganawa as Sui Usami
Rui Tanabe as Tobari Haneda
Manami Numakura as Karin Ryuzaki
Misato Fukuen as Machi Nezu
Reina Ueda as Neneko Kurosawa
Yui Ishikawa as Aoi Wakaba
Yui Horie as Maki Okonogi
STAFF:
Director: Akira Iwanaga
Series Composition: Katsuhiko Takayama
Character Design: Maiko Okada
Music: Makoto Miyazaki
Animation Production: asread.
Yen Press publishes the English-language edition of the original light novel by Kurusu Natsume and Sai Izumi, describing the series as follows:
I’m Rei Hitoma, a self-professed misanthrope thanks to some past trauma. Just when I thought my new teaching job in the mountains would provide a chill, rejuvenating environment, it turns out that this school is actually for demi-humans who want to become full-fledged human beings! There’s a mermaid, a werewolf, a rabbit, and a bird…all of whom are now my charges. It’s my duty to teach them about humankind—and maybe in the process, I’ll learn a few things myself. This isn’t an alternate world or a case of reincarnation. It’s just the story of a teacher at a somewhat peculiar school and his students who are striving to become human.
